Title: Taro Yamazaki: Innovator in Laser Beam Stabilization
Introduction
Taro Yamazaki is a notable inventor based in Himeji, Japan. He has made significant contributions to the field of image reproduction technology. His innovative work focuses on stabilizing laser beams for exposure purposes.
Latest Patents
Yamazaki holds a patent for an "Apparatus for stabilizing beam for exposure." This apparatus is designed to stabilize a laser beam used in image-reproducing devices. The laser beam is modulated by image signals obtained from scanning the original beam. The technology branches the laser beam into two paths using a half mirror. One beam is utilized for exposing photosensitive material, while the other serves as a negative feedback signal. This feedback is integrated with the image signal, enhancing the linearity between the exposing beam and the image signals. Consequently, the stability of the exposing beam is also improved.
Career Highlights
Throughout his career, Taro Yamazaki has worked with prominent companies such as Dainippon Screen Manufacturing Co., Ltd. and Ushio Electric Inc. His experience in these organizations has contributed to his expertise in laser technology and image reproduction.
Collaborations
Yamazaki has collaborated with notable colleagues, including Kazuhiko Ohnishi and Kiyoshi Maeda. Their joint efforts have further advanced the field of laser beam stabilization.
